Pinout
| Pin | Name | Type | Function |
|---|---|---|---|
| 1 | ISENSE | input | Current sense input pin. Connects to the drain node of the external PFET so that RDS(on) sensing can be compared against the ADJ threshold for cycle-by-cycle current limiting. |
| 2 | GND | power_in | Signal ground reference for the controller. |
| 3 | NC | unconnected | No internal connection. |
| 4 | FB | input | Feedback input. Connect to a resistor divider between the regulated output and GND to program the output voltage; internal reference is 1.242 V (typical). |
| 5 | ADJ | input | Current-limit threshold adjustment. Sources ~5.5 µA from an internal current source through an external resistor to VIN; the resulting voltage sets the RDS(on)-based over-current trip level compared with the PFET VDS. |
| 6 | PWR GND | power_in | Power ground for the gate driver return current. |
| 7 | PGATE | output | Gate drive output for the external P-channel MOSFET. Output swings between VIN and (VIN − 5 V); source/sink driver resistance ~5.5 Ω / 8.5 Ω. |
| 8 | VIN | power_in | Power supply input pin. Operating range 4.5 V to 35 V. |
